Summary

It may have been billed as the NASCAR All-Star Race, but it looked and played out like a regular points race at Dover. Denny Hamlin continued his excellence at the Monster Mile, and now we're left scratching our heads on what to do with the All-Star Race. Our resident NASCAR reporters Jeff Gluck and Jordan Bianchi were on the case at Dover, and they took to the airwaves after the race to air their grievances and ponder suggestions to help save the struggling exhibition race in the future.
